Description
Copper Beryllium is a high-performance alloy renowned for its exceptional combination of strength, conductivity, and non-sparking properties. This material is critical for demanding applications where reliability under stress, fatigue resistance, and electrical performance are paramount. It is an essential engineering material for the aerospace, automotive, electronics, and oil & gas industries, serving in components that require durability and precision.
Application
- Aerospace Components: Used in critical aircraft parts such as bearings, bushings, and landing gear components due to its high strength-to-weight ratio and fatigue resistance.
- Electronics & Connectors: Essential for manufacturing high-reliability electrical connectors, switches, and relay springs where excellent conductivity and spring properties are required.
- Non-Sparking Tools: A key material for tools used in explosive environments like oil refineries and chemical plants, as it does not generate sparks upon impact.
- Automotive Systems: Employed in advanced automotive systems, including sensors, connectors, and valve seats, for its durability and thermal management.
- Industrial Machinery: Used in wear plates, springs, and molds that require high strength, corrosion resistance, and good thermal conductivity.
- Precision Instruments: Ideal for components in measuring devices and instruments that demand dimensional stability and resistance to deformation.

Specification
| Item | Specification |
|---|---|
| Appearance | Metallic solid (rod, strip, wire, etc.) |
| Beryllium Content | 0.5% - 2.0% (Typical) |
| Cobalt/Nickel Content | 0.20% - 0.60% (Typical) |
| Tensile Strength | Up to 200 ksi (1380 MPa) |
| Rockwell Hardness | Up to C44 |
| Electrical Conductivity | 15% - 30% IACS |
| Fatigue Strength | High |
| Corrosion Resistance | Excellent |
